無(wú)法刪除MySQL怎么辦?這是許多數(shù)據(jù)庫(kù)管理員經(jīng)常遇到的問(wèn)題。在本文中,我們將探討一些可能導(dǎo)致無(wú)法刪除MySQL的原因,并提供解決方案。
1.權(quán)限問(wèn)題
首先,您需要確保您擁有足夠的權(quán)限來(lái)刪除MySQL。如果您沒(méi)有足夠的權(quán)限,則無(wú)法刪除MySQL。您可以使用以下命令檢查您的權(quán)限:
SHOW GRANTS FOR CURRENT_USER;
如果您沒(méi)有足夠的權(quán)限,則可以使用以下命令為您的用戶添加權(quán)限:
ame'@'localhost' IDENTIFIED BY 'yourpassword' WITH GRANT OPTION;
2.進(jìn)程問(wèn)題
如果有其他進(jìn)程正在使用MySQL,您可能無(wú)法刪除它。您可以使用以下命令查看當(dāng)前正在運(yùn)行的MySQL進(jìn)程:
SHOW PROCESSLIST;
如果您發(fā)現(xiàn)有其他進(jìn)程正在使用MySQL,則可以使用以下命令殺死進(jìn)程:
KILL processid;
3.文件系統(tǒng)問(wèn)題
如果MySQL數(shù)據(jù)目錄中的文件被損壞或不完整,您可能無(wú)法刪除MySQL。您可以使用以下命令檢查MySQL數(shù)據(jù)目錄中的文件:
SHOW VARIABLES LIKE 'datadir';
如果您發(fā)現(xiàn)文件損壞或不完整,則可以嘗試修復(fù)它們或重建它們。
4.版本問(wèn)題
如果您正在運(yùn)行的MySQL版本過(guò)舊,您可能無(wú)法刪除MySQL。您可以使用以下命令檢查您的MySQL版本:
SELECT VERSION();
如果您的MySQL版本過(guò)舊,則可以嘗試升級(jí)到最新版本。
無(wú)法刪除MySQL可能有多種原因,包括權(quán)限問(wèn)題、進(jìn)程問(wèn)題、文件系統(tǒng)問(wèn)題和版本問(wèn)題。您可以使用以上提到的命令和解決方案來(lái)解決這些問(wèn)題。如果您仍然無(wú)法刪除MySQL,請(qǐng)考慮聯(lián)系MySQL支持人員以獲得更多幫助。